WebAscariasis is one of the most common human parasitic infections. It infects more than 1 billion people worldwide. Ascariasis is most common in children between 3 and 8 years old. It doesn’t occur frequently in the United States. But you may get ascariasis if you travel to an area of the world with poor sanitation. Who is at risk for ascariasis?
